Household of Columbus C Bridges

He is married to Nancy Elizabeth Blanton.

They got married on November 28, 1878, he was 16 years old.Source 1


Child(ren):

  1. Bessie Bridges  1879-????
  2. Dorcas Bridges  1880-????
  3. Osdar Bridges  1881-????
  4. Gus Bridges  1882-????
  5. Coran Bridges  1883-????
  6. Maude Bridges  1884-????
  7. Cleo Bridges  1885-????
